In Short
Red-and-white tablecloths, family-sized tables and friendly staff contribute to the convivial atmosphere for those dining in, but this popular local restaurant chain is a favorite for takeout, too. Thin-crust pizzas are cut in squares, heavy on mozzarella, easy on sauce. Stuffed pies are flaky-crusted with ingredients that include fresh pineapple, shrimp and classic pepperoni, onion, green pepper and the like. Other popular plates include sandwiches (Italian beef, sausage, meatball), salads and a plethora of pasta dishes.

Try the fried mushrooms. The mushrooms were fresh and juicy with crunchy breading. We had the pepperoni and sausage deep dish pizza. It was loaded and quite good. We got the small (2 of us) but could not finish. Like all deep dish pizzas, the portions are huge. We didn't realize that they had personal sized ones until we glanced over at our neighboring table. Cooking time was 20-30 minutes. The waitress was friendly and helpful.

Know Before You Go:

Stuffed pizzas take 30-40 minutes to bake, so it's a good idea to call and place your order ahead of time.
